Wednesday, September 27, 2023

Logo Central America Link

Panama's Soho is Central America's number one

Thursday, May 14, 2015

The recently opened Soho Panama Mall on Calle 50, is the most modern and most luxurious commercial center in Central America and promises to be a magnet for not only local residents, but well-heeled tourists.

But with its multiplicity of stores it will also attract the selective shopper looking for quality.

Source: Business Recorder